Blackburn distance themselves from relegation beating Sunderland, 2-0

Goals from Junior Hoilett and Yakubu powered Blackburn to a 2 nothing victory over Sunderland. With this win, Blackburn look poised to stave off relegation quite comfortably.

The question to ask of Blackburn fans who have been baying for Steve Kean's blood. You've gone all season blaming him for the club's problems. When will you start giving him credit for this turnaround? He's had to grow a tough hide while he faces a constant barrage of criticism and invective. Yet, he rolls up his sleeves and comes to work everyday making no excuses. Look at Wolves. Steve Morgan fired Mick McCarthy and they are now in the toilet.

Only five teams have outscored Blackburn. The priority is clear next season. A better defense.
